Located in the heart of Rome at Via Norcia, 69, Cinque Spicchi stands out as a genuine gem for lovers of Roman-style pizza. This pizzeria nails the essence of traditional pizza romana—thin, crisp, yet surprisingly soft and light—offering a bite that delights with every chew. The dough, masterfully crafted by the skilled pizzaiolo, strikes that perfect balance between crunch and digestibility, making it one of the best examples of Roman pizza in the city, according to multiple patrons.

Beyond pizza, this restaurant’s fritti deserves special mention. Light, crispy, and impeccably ungreasy, these fried starters are perfect for sharing and set a high standard rarely encountered elsewhere. Their excellence mirrors the quality of the arrosticini, a grilled delicacy that Danièle Cavalieri praises as “ottimi.” Together, they enrich the menu with textures and flavors that complement its star dishes.
The ambiance at Cinque Spicchi is unpretentious yet inviting, reflecting the neighborhood’s warm, authentic vibe. Both indoor and outdoor seating options allow guests to enjoy their meals in comfort, whether seeking shelter inside or savoring Rome’s summer breeze on the terrace. Coupled with attentive and courteous service, the dining experience here is seamless and welcoming.
Finally, the value proposition is noteworthy. With moderate pricing—such as a meal for four around 60 euros—and high-quality food and service, Cinque Spicchi achieves a rare harmony of affordability and excellence.
